I have been very happy with Sony Bravia LED TVs, on my third or fourth one now. I upgrade to a bigger size when they get less expensive--currently on a 65" from Costco. You might think you don't want a big TV, but then you'll be watching your sports, or a movie, and be glad of it.

You save a lot by getting an LED TV instead of an "OLED" TV. OLED has deeper blacks, I think. I think this is the one I have, a few hundred dollars cheaper than when I bought it:


An aftermarket sound bar with subwoofer (or home sound system) improves the experience a lot!
